The weather this weekend is scary in several places around the country. We suggest running early in the morning or in the evening if it is too hot, or you are in flood areas. With forest fires on West coast, floods in Texas, and hot weather in other parts of country, think before you run.

Monday, warm up, one mile easy, 50 minute Holmer Fartlek run , go out in 28 minutes, come back in
22 minutes, easy one mile cooldown
Tuesday, warm up, easy 2 miles, run ten 200 meter hill repeats, shorten stride, pump arms, look down
at your feet, jog down easy, repeat, then, 2 mile run, then, cooldown
Wednesday, warm up, easy 40-45 minute minute run, three times 150 meter stride outs, cooldown.
Thursday, warm up, find one mile hilly course, and run it hard, jog for five minutes and repeat four times, co
then, one mile cooldown,
Friday, warm up, easy 40-45 minute run with two 150 meter stride outs, then cooldown
Saturday, warm up, 5k trail race, the more hills, the better, cooldown. NOTE, if you
it too hot, in flood area, keep day easy.
Sunday, warm up, 75 minutes, in hills, cooldown
